Wallaby arrested in Japan

The Yomiuri Shimbun daily reported that the Reds star was arrested after assaulting a taxi driver on December 31.

According to the report, the assault occurred after the intoxicated Smith refused to pay the taxi fare.

The 111 Test-capped Wallaby, who is currently based in Tokyo at Suntory Sungoliath during Super Rugby's off-season, denied the allegations, the paper added.

However, Suntory confirmed his arrest in a statement.

"It is true that George Smith, under contract to our rugby team, has been arrested," the statement stated.

"We issue a heartfelt apology to the victim, as well as other related people, as well as to the many people who have worried and been caused problems by this,"
